BigCommerce vs New Relic Browser: 2026 Comparison

BigCommerce New Relic Browser
Overview An enterprise-grade e-commerce platform with built-in features for scaling online businesses without transaction fees. New Relic Browser provides real-time performance monitoring for web applications with detailed JavaScript error tracking. It measures core web vitals and page load times across real user sessions.
Pricing Subscription ($39-$399/month) Freemium ($0-custom)
